Introduce children to the life and music of Bob Marley with this engaging Year 1 reading comprehension activity. Designed to support early reading skills, this simple and accessible comprehension resource helps children learn about an inspirational Black musician while developing their ability to read, identify key information and answer questions. Children will read a short, child-friendly text about Bob Marley before completing activities that encourage word recognition, vocabulary development and reading comprehension. Pupils will identify key words from the text and answer questions to demonstrate their understanding. This resource is differentiated three ways, making it suitable for a range of reading abilities within Year 1 classrooms. It is ideal for use during Black History Month, literacy lessons, guided reading sessions, independent work or as part of a topic on significant people.
